Luke Serwach, untitled, Polaroid SLR 680, TIP PX680 film, Kinoflo lights, 2011
Polish photographer Luke Serwach of Warsaw made this fabulous photo that brought me to a screeching halt when I discovered this and similar photos of his while surfing the web. This is a work of art.
Luke writes that he had a site under construction which will be finished in approximately 4-6 weeks, at which time I'll add the link to this post.